George Brown announce that Men's Volleyball coaches Sam Schachter and Luke Sim are stepping down from their leadership roles with the Huskies ahead of the 2024-25 season. Both coaches played a vital role in the program's significant strides over the past three seasons.
"We’re sad to see Sam and Luke both go, but we’re thrilled with the impact they both made on the program during their time here and the positive position they’ve put us in to continue to be successful moving forward," said Melanie Gerin-Lajoie, Manager of Athletics & Recreation. "And we wish Sam best of luck as he continues to challenge for another Olympic birth with the national beach team!".
Sam Schachter was named head coach of the team in April 2021. He had the difficult challenge of compiling a roster after a year hiatus due to COVID, but in his first season the team still went 3-5 and qualified for the playoffs. The following campaign, he took a step back from head coach to consultant in order to focus on his beach volleyball career with the hopes of qualifying for the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ris, France.

Sim was brought in as an assistant with Schachter ahead of the 2021-2022 campaign, and took over as interim head coach for 2023-24. After a season of growth, the program turned it around in a massive way. The Huskies improved their win total by eight from the previous season, ending with an impressive 11-7 record, securing fourth place in the division and hosting a crossover playoff match for the first time since 2018. Sim was named East Division Coach of the Year and was a nominee for George Brown Huskies Coach of the Year.
